a) You can ask such questions at http://forum.kde.org
b) "something" very much likely overrode your ~/.kde[4]/share/config/plasma*rc 
files ->
c) Re-installing is *never* a reasonable solution to any problem (but windows) 
and in this case *very* much likely will at best make things not worse, but not 
restore your former settings.

Check whether the distro changed the KDEDIR settings (ie. whether you now eg. 
have ~/.kde AND ~/.kde4)
If not and you don't have a backup of your configuration, it's very most  
likely lost and you'll have to recreate it, sorry.
